IRM Energy Q1 FY27 Earnings Call — Analysis (NSE: IRMENERGY)

IRM Energy delivered its highest-ever quarterly revenue, EBITDA, and PAT in Q1FY27, driven by prudent gas sourcing and volume growth despite geopolitical volatility.

Results

Revenue ₹326 Cr +24% YoY; EBITDA ₹62 Cr +139% YoY (margin 19%); PAT ₹34 Cr +140% YoY; volumes 50.9 MMSCM +8% YoY.

Guidance

FY27 EBITDA per SCM guided at ₹7-8, revenue growth of ~20-25%, volume growth 10-12%, and capex of ₹250 Cr.
